Learn so much from done

Published: Thursday, 24 January 2013

Whenever I read a business book, I always think I've got the general gist of it and put it down sometime through.  Otherwise, I read it non-chronologically to get the idea of it.

One time when I read a book though, I decided to break through thinking I'd gotten the gist.  I read the whole thing.  By reading the whole thing, I realised I got the last 20% of the idea the writer wanted me to get.

Similarly, that is my attitude with projects.  Don't just do half of it.  Do the whole thing thoroughly and completely, and that is how you'll get the most out of it.
